The inspector’s account

It was alleged that the licensee did not provide client medical care . Interviews revealed that staff provide medical care to the clients when they need it. Interviews revealed they assess clients with needing care if they have a change in behavior, if they are able to voice it and or they see a difference in how the client usually behaves. Interviews revealed there have been incidents that have happened but no injury or medical assistance was needed.

LPA Holmes collected pertinent client records and based on C1’s Physician Report dated 09/12/2024 C1 is diagnosed with Autism and Severe Intellectual Disability, is unable to communicate; C1 requires assistance with all grooming, medication, bathing, toileting, and management of personal resources which C1 and other staff assists C1 with.

Based on C1’s records collected, C1 is non-verbal and unable to communicate needs.

The Department has investigated the above-mentioned allegations and based on interviews with staff, clients and outside sources, the preponderance of the evidence has not been met, therefore, this allegation is deemed unsubstantiated.
